Kilkenny woman extremely ill in Toyko after drinking coffee was allergic to

A young woman from Kilkenny is seriously ill in a Tokyo hospital after drinking a coffee she is allergic to.

Aika Doheny, in her twenties, had gone on vacation to Japan but a few weeks ago fell seriously ill while drinking coffee, reports the Mirror.

Ms Doheny is an alumnus of Presentation Secondary School and is studying at the National University of Ireland in Galway to become a research assistant.

It is believed that several efforts were made to try to relieve the allergic reaction she had to the drink with an Epipen, but the effects were limited and she was taken to a nearby hospital in Tokyo.

The young woman has been in intensive care for a few weeks and efforts are now being made to bring her back from Japan on an ambulance plane.

However, the cost to bring her home would exceed several hundred thousand euros and a planned fundraiser is to be launched soon to help fund the cost of repatriation to a hospital in Dublin.
